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Facilities and Amenities at Morar Station

Morar station, operated without a ticket office, invites travelers to soak in its rustic allure. It lacks ticket machines, so it's advisable to purchase tickets in advance or online. While smartcards are not issued at this station, validators are available to ensure your journey is off to a smooth start. Accessibility is key; however, travelers might face challenges such as limited step-free access and uneven ground. The station is equipped with a help point, although there is no staff assistance available on site.

With no waiting rooms or first-class lounges, visitors are encouraged to take in the serene surroundings while resting on the available seating. There are no refreshment facilities, so plan to bring along your favorite snacks and beverages. And while the station does not feature Wi-Fi or payphones, it does offer bicycle storage with sheltered stands for those venturing out on two wheels.

Facilities and Amenities at Coatbridge Sunnyside

At Coatbridge Sunnyside, passengers are greeted with a user-friendly environment. The station is equipped with a ticket office that is open Monday through Saturday from 05:46 to 19:34 and offers ticket machines for convenience. For those who prefer to plan ahead, tickets purchased online can be collected from the available machines. Accessibility is a priority here with step-free access to platform 1 and a helpful assistance program available for those requiring extra support.

Customer service is always at the forefront. Should you need assistance, staff help is available during office hours, and customer help points are strategically located around the station. CCTV surveillance ensures security around the clock. However, it's worth noting that there aren't any luggage storage facilities, so plan accordingly if you have heavy baggage in tow.
